Garlic Mashed Potatoes

Creamy rich and indulgent, these garlic mashed potatoes are one delicious side dish. Simple to make with a few basic ingredients, they come together in minutes and are the perfect accompaniment to all of your favorite meals.

Ingredients

  • 3 lbs yukon gold potatoes
  • 1 cup heavy cream
  • 2 garlic cloves minced
  • 1 stick of unsalted butter
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Chives for serving

Instructions

  • Peel the potatoes and cut them into large chunks. Then place them in a large pot. Cover the potatoes with water and boil for 10 minutes or until the potatoes are tender and you can easily pierce them with a fork.
  • While the potatoes are boiling, heat the heavy cream, garlic cloves, and butter in a large saucepan over medium heat.
  • Once the potatoes are done boiling, drain them and then add them into the heavy cream mixture. Make sure to remove the pot from the heat. Mash the potatoes until you reach the desired consistency and then stir until smooth and creamy. Season with salt and pepper to taste. Top with chives if desired.

Notes

  • Cut the potatoes into similar sized chunks so that they cook evenly. They should be fork tender so that they are easy to mash.
  • If you want even fluffier mash, use a potato ricer instead of a hand masher.
  • Don't over mash the potatoes. Over mashing can cause them to become thick and gluey.
  • If making ahead of time, let them cool before refrigerating.
